Seared Salmon Fillet with Garlic Green Beans and Cauliflower Mash
Savor a perfectly seared salmon fillet paired with vibrant garlic green beans and a silky cauliflower mash enriched with a touch of creamy Greek yogurt. This balanced meal offers a delightful blend of textures and flavors, from the crisp sautéed beans to the smooth, comforting mash, all harmonized by the rich, flavorful salmon.
INGREDIENTS
6 oz Salmon Fillet
1 cup Green Beans
1 cup Cauliflower florets
1/4 cup Plain Nonfat Greek Yogurt
1 tsp Olive Oil
2 cloves Garlic
Salt & Pepper to taste
PREPARATION
Pat the salmon fillet dry and season both sides with salt and pepper.
Preheat a skillet over medium-high heat with the olive oil.
Place the salmon skin-side down (if applicable) in the hot skillet and sear for about 3-4 minutes, then flip and cook for an additional 3-4 minutes until cooked through.
While the salmon is searing, steam the green beans until crisp-tender, about 4-5 minutes. In the last minute, add minced garlic to the green beans and toss to coat.
Meanwhile, steam the cauliflower florets until soft, about 8-10 minutes. Transfer to a bowl and add Greek yogurt, a pinch of salt and pepper. Mash until smooth and creamy.
Plate the seared salmon alongside the garlic green beans and a generous serving of cauliflower mash. Enjoy your balanced dinner!
